World Cruise 2015 Trivia
Here
are some pieces of trivial information about the upcoming World Cruise.
How
far will the Pacific Princess Travel?
·
65,081
Kilometers
·
35,141
Nautical Miles
·
40,439
Statute Miles
How
many ports will we visit?
·
33
Ports
To
how many continents will the Pacific Princess travel?
·
Six
Will
the Pacific Princess cross the Equator?
·
Yes,
twice. Prior to arriving at Apia,
Western Samoa and after leaving Darwin, Australia.
What
affect will crossing the International Date Line have on the cruise?
·
This
will cause us to lose or not have February 2, 2015.
How
many laps around the Pacific Princess Jogging Track equal a mile?
·
13
laps
What
are the vital statistics for the Pacific Princess?
·
Passenger
Capacity 680
·
Length
593 feet
·
Gross
Tonnage 30,200
WORLD
CRUISE SEGMENTS
1.
Los
Angeles to Sydney 23 Jan 15 (22 days)
2.
Sidney
to Hong Kong 15 Feb 15 (18 days)
3.
Hong
Kong to Dubai 5 Mar 15 (20 days)
4.
Dubai
to Rome 25 Mar 15 (16 days)
5.
Rome
to Fort Lauderdale 10 Apr 15 (18 days)
6.
Fort
Lauderdale to Los Angeles 28 Apr 15 (17 days)

Changed Staterooms
After watching pricing and other factors for a long time, today we changed from stateroom 7107 to 7121 which is an aft-facing balcony. This will afford us more balcony space on this 111-day cruise which is extremely sea-day intensive (71 sea days). We were able to pickup additional on board credit due to the sale that Princess is currently running. Looking forward to this great cruise.

Cancelled and Rebooked
Two days ago, we cancelled the World Cruise and immediately rebooked at a substantially lower fare. Of course we lost the $1000 each in on board credit (OBC), but the discounted fare made up for this and more. We were able to keep our stateroom on the starboard side of the ship. More On Board Credit
Want more on board credit (OBC) to use during
the World Cruise? There is an easy way to get those dollars you can
spend for shore excursions or other purchases on the ship. One of
the best ways I would recommend is by getting a Princess Cruises Rewards Visa
card. You earn 1 point for each US dollar you charge to the card or two (2) Princess Points for every one U.S.
dollar ($1.00) of Net Purchases from Princess Cruise Lines including purchase
of the cruise itself and onboard purchases.
As far as how much you can
get in OBC depends on how much you spend. But, for example, say you
purchased the World Cruise using your card. An example would be, if
the cost of the Princess cruise is $20,000 US dollars, this would equal 40,000
Princess Points which can be redeemed for $500 OBC. It can also be
redeemed for other things (See the program details).
Our goal is to accumulate
as many Princess Points as possible prior to the World Cruise, so our shore
excursions will be covered.
